US Rep. Thomas Massie’s GOP primary in Kentucky is the latest test of Trump’s power over the party
The race has become the most expensive U.S. House primary in history, with Trump and allied groups backing Gallrein against Massie.
- On Tuesday, May 19, 2026, voters in Kentucky's 4th Congressional District choose between seven-term incumbent Representative Thomas Massie and Trump-backed challenger Ed Gallrein in a closely watched Republican primary.
- President Donald Trump personally recruited Gallrein last October to remove Massie, who has defied him on the Epstein files, the Iran war, and spending legislation.
- Campaigns and outside groups have spent more than $32 million on television ads, making this the most expensive House primary in U.S. history, with recent polls showing a deadlocked race.
- A loss for Massie would demonstrate Trump's power to enforce party discipline; a victory might signal limits to his influence over GOP voters ahead of November.
- This primary serves as a national bellwether for party cohesion, testing whether Trump's endorsement can outweigh an incumbent's established local relationships in a deeply Republican district.
